Selection Process
| Stage 1: Desk Evaluation and GMST/SAT score | |
|---|---|
| Desk Evaluation | Applicants are required to complete the online registration through um.ugm.ac.id in accordance with the official IUP admission schedule and submit all required application documents. All submitted documents, including academic records, SAT certificate (if any), and proof of English proficiency, will be reviewed by the selection committee as part of the Desk Evaluation. |
| Regarding English proficiency, applicants are required to upload a recognized English proficiency certificate. Applicants who wish to take the AcEPT test may still do so, while those who choose not to take the test may proceed using their uploaded certificate. | |
| GMST/SAT Score | After submitting the required documents, applicants’ documents will be verified by the committee, after which eligible applicants will proceed to the Gadjah Mada Scholastic Test (GMST). |
| Applicants who already possess a valid SAT score may use it as a substitute for the GMST. After document verification by the committee, applicants with an SAT score may still choose to take the GMST, and this option will be provided in the system. | Stage 2: Interview |
| Interview | Based on the results of the Stage 1, selected applicants will be invited to proceed to the Interview stage. |
Admission Requirements
- Scanned copy of a valid ID card (e.g., KTP, passport)
- Curriculum Vitae (CV)
- Motivation Letter
- Scanned scores of SNBT UTBK, or SAT (Scholastic Assessment Test), or high school academic transcripts (semester 1 – semester 5). For international students, high school institutions must have equivalent qualifications to A-Level or International Baccalaureate or be endorsed by the Indonesian Embassy in the country of origin. The transcripts must be in English.
- English Proficiency Certificate: Institutional TOEFL PBT (500 or above), TOEFL iBT (61 or above), IELTS (6 or above), Duo Lingo (110 or above), AcEPT (268 or above). Please note that Applicants must meet the minimum English proficiency score set by the specific study program, which may exceed the scores mentioned above. It is highly recommended to consult the respective program's website for detailed information, as requirements may vary across programs.
*)For the Urban and Regional Planning program, the minimum English proficiency scores are as follows: Institutional TOEFL PBT (550 or above)/TOEFL iBT (80 or above)/IELTS (6.5 or above)/Duolingo (105 or above)/AcEPT (326 or above). - Scanned certificates of the most prestigious awards (if available)
- Letter of Financial Commitment
Admission Pathway
Account Creation and Registration
- Register and create an account at admissions.ugm.ac.id
- Complete the required data and upload supporting documents in the registration account. Ensure that all information provided is correct and complies with the upload requirements before clicking Finalize Registration.
- Applicants may edit their data as long as they have not clicked Lock Data and the registration period is still open.
Verification by the Selection Committee
- All submitted data and supporting documents will be verified by the Selection Committee. This stage is the Desk Evaluation.
- Applicants are advised to regularly check the verification status in their respective accounts after finalize the registration, as test-related information will be provided there.
- Applicants whose English proficiency certificates are verified may choose to use the certificate for the selection process or to take the AcEPT. Applicants whose certificates are not verified are required to take the AcEPT.
- Applicants who upload an SAT score and whose score is verified may choose to use the score for the selection process or to take the GMST. Applicants who do not upload an SAT score are required to take the GMST.
Test
- The selection schedule will be stated on the Test Card, which can be printed after registration finalization and completion of the verification process.
- The test will be conducted on-site at UGM for intake 1 and 3, and Online for intake 2. Detailed information on the test time and location will be provided on each applicant’s Test Card.
Interview
- Applicants who pass Stage 1 will be invited to proceed to Stage 2, the Interview.
- Invitations are usually sent via WhatsApp or email. Applicants are advised to check regularly.
Final Announcement
- The final results will be announced in each applicant’s account on the scheduled announcement date.
